WASHINGTON, Dec. 8 -- Rep. Jennifer Wexton, D-Virginia, issued the following news release on Dec. 7, 2021:
Congresswoman Jennifer Wexton (D-VA) voted to pass the Fiscal Year 2022 National Defense Authorization Act (NDAA), which makes key investments to strengthen national security and support U.S. servicemembers and their families.
"This year's bipartisan defense authorization bill invests in our servicemembers who are the core of our national security," . . .
